Srinagar, Mar 04: Manoj Sinha on Tuesday chaired a high-level meeting of senior police and civil administration officials at the Police Control Room, Kashmir, to review the prevailing law and order situation.
The meeting was attended by Nalin Prabhat, DGP J&K; S.J.M. Gillani, Special DG (Coordination); Anand Jain, ADGP Armed; Nitish Kumar, ADGP CID; V.K. Birdi, IGP Kashmir; Anshul Garg, Divisional Commissioner Kashmir; Rajiv Pandey, DIG CKR; Akshay Labroo, Deputy Commissioner Srinagar, along with other senior officials.
The Lieutenant Governor directed officers to remain on heightened alert and take all necessary steps to maintain public peace and tranquillity across the region.
He also appealed to citizens and community leaders to uphold harmony and help foster an atmosphere of calm and goodwill in society.
“Preserving peace and sustaining the progress of society is a shared responsibility that rests equally upon each one of us,” he said.
In a post on X, the Lieutenant Governor stated that he had reviewed the law and order situation and instructed officials to ensure strict vigilance and proactive measures to safeguard peace. He reiterated his appeal to the public to maintain unity and contribute to social harmony. (Agency)
